Summary
AI-generated from the abstractIntravenous ketamine given in a supportive environment with preparation, intention-setting, and integration sessions—similar to psychedelic therapy—led to large reductions in PTSD symptoms. In 117 outpatients with elevated PTSD Checklist scores, the mean score dropped from 52.54 to 28.78, a large effect size of 1.64. No serious adverse events occurred. Concomitant psychotherapy also contributed to improvement. Of the patients, 75% showed clinically meaningful improvement and 62% showed remission of symptoms. The results suggest that environmental factors may account for variation in previous ketamine studies.

Abstract
Background: Traditional treatments for Post-Traumatic Stress Disorder (PTSD) often show limited success with high dropout. Ketamine, an N-methyl-D-aspartate antagonist known for rapid antidepressant effects, has decreased PTSD symptoms in some studies but not others. Administering ketamine in ways that parallel psychedelic-assisted treatments—including preparatory, integration, sensory immersion, and psychotherapy sessions—could decrease PTSD symptoms meaningfully.Methods: A sample of 117 screened outpatients with elevated PTSD Checklist for DSM-5 (PCL-5) scores received intravenous ketamine in supportive environments. The protocol included preparation, intention-setting, and integration sessions accompanying at least six administrations. Administration sessions included eye shades and evocative music paralleling typical psychedelic therapy trials.Results: Mean PCL scores decreased from 52.54 (SD = 12.01) to 28.78 (SD = 16.61), d = 1.64. Patients tolerated treatment well, with no serious adverse events. Covariates, including age, gender, days between PCL assessments, number of psychiatric medications, and suicidal ideation were not significant moderators; concomitant psychotherapy did reach significance, d = 0.51. Of the 117 patients’ final PCL scores, 88 (75.21%) measures suggested clinically meaningful improvement and 72 (61.54%) suggested remission of PTSD symptoms.Conclusion: Intravenous ketamine in supportive environments, with hallmarks of psychedelic therapy, preceded large reductions in PTSD symptoms. These results highlight ketamine’s potential when delivered in this manner, suggesting environmental factors might account for some variation seen in previous work. Given the molecule’s cost, minimal interaction with other psychiatric medications, and legal status, intravenous ketamine in a psychedelic paradigm may be a promising option for PTSD unresponsive to other treatments.
